What is Brian?

Brian (brian.study) is an AI-powered learning platform designed for students and self-learners to efficiently process study materials. The application automatically transforms lecture slides, textbooks, and PDFs into interactive study aids such as flashcards, summaries, and multiple-choice quizzes.

Powered by advanced language models, the tool explains complex academic concepts clearly and answers specific questions about uploaded documents. Users can chat directly with their study materials, identify knowledge gaps, and track their learning progress over time.

Beyond individual study use, Brian is also leveraged by educational institutions and companies for exam preparation and employee onboarding. Through gamified elements and spaced repetition techniques, the platform promotes long-term knowledge retention.

Who is this tool for?

Brian is tailored for university students, educators, and lifelong learners looking to streamline their study routines and master dense academic materials. Organizations also use it for corporate training and structured onboarding.

Typical use case

A university student uploads a 100-page biology textbook PDF to brian.study. The AI analyzes the content, creating concise chapter summaries and flashcards within minutes. During exam preparation, the student uses the document chat to clarify difficult topics and tests knowledge using automatically generated practice quizzes.

When a different tool fits better

The platform is not intended as a general-purpose text writing assistant without source documents, as it is specialized in educational analysis and study aids. Users seeking open-ended creative writing should use standard AI chatbots instead.

How does Brian handle data privacy?

Data processing is handled by AskBrian GmbH based in Germany on European servers adhering to GDPR guidelines. Uploaded study materials and user inputs are not utilized to train public AI models. Ideal for academic notes and study materials, but highly sensitive personal data should be avoided.
